The image depicts an agricultural processing scene in Bazar-e Panjva'i, Afghanistan, centered on a large-scale raisin operation. In the foreground, a substantial, irregular mound of light brown and amber-colored raisins, varying in size, dominates the lower right and central portions of the frame. These raisins rest on a light blue tarp laid over dry, earthen ground. Three males are present, engaged in activities related to the raisins. In the foreground-left, a young male, wearing a light-colored tunic (perahan tunban) and a patterned circular cap, is crouched with his back mostly to the viewer, actively sorting or manipulating a smaller pile of raisins. His bare feet are visible on the tarp. To his immediate left, an adult male with a beard, dressed similarly in light traditional attire and a cap, is seated and appears to be involved in a similar sorting task. In the mid-ground right, another young male, also in a light tunic, stands or kneels behind the main raisin pile, looking down at the produce. The background features a rustic, open-air wooden structure constructed from poles and beams. From this structure, numerous bunches of drying grapes or similar produce hang, forming a textured backdrop of green and yellowish-brown. A dark plastic crate is partially visible behind the foreground individual. The scene is brightly illuminated by natural light, suggesting an outdoor or semi-sheltered environment characteristic of agricultural drying and sorting operations.
